On October 30, 1997, Online Gaming Review reported that the game had gone gold. It would become available in the stores a few days later, in the week of November 10th.

On October 27th, 2000, LucasArts announced in a newsletter (LucasArts Insider #3) that Escape from Monkey Island had gone gold. The game would become available in the stores a few days later.

Return to Monkey Island was released on September 19, 2022. The first "official" day of development was July 20, 2020. Source: grumpygamer.com/dev_diary/

The gold master floppy disks were created on September 2, 1990, and the game reached stores later that September or in October.
Source: grumpygamer.com/monkey25/
